    Job description

    New York, New York - 2026-07-10
    We are seeking a Senior NetApp Storage Engineer with deep expertise in NetApp ONTAP, core NetApp technologies, and enterprise storage infrastructure. This role requires a highly experienced, proactive, and consultative professional who can lead complex storage initiatives, support hardware break/fix activities, and provide technical leadership for strategic storage projects.
    The ideal candidate will serve as a trusted storage subject matter expert (SME), bringing both hands-on technical expertise and the ability to advise stakeholders on best practices, architecture, and future-state storage solutions.
    This position is primarily remote; however, candidates must reside within the New York City metropolitan area and be available to go onsite as needed (possibly 2 to 3 times per week).
    AS A NETAPP ENGINEER, YOU CAN EXPECT TO HAVE THESE RESPONSIBILITIES:
    • Serve as the primary subject matter expert (SME) for NetApp ONTAP and core NetApp storage technologies
    • Lead and execute hardware break/fix, maintenance, and troubleshooting activities across NetApp storage environments
    • Provide technical consultation, recommendations, and leadership for special storage-related projects
    • Manage and support NetApp FAS and AFF platforms in enterprise environments
    • Perform storage performance analysis, optimization, capacity planning, and health assessments
    • Troubleshoot complex storage, SAN/NAS, and infrastructure issues
    • Collaborate with infrastructure, engineering, and application teams to ensure system reliability, scalability, and data integrity
    • Drive proactive improvements and recommend best practices for storage administration and operations
    • Support data protection, replication, disaster recovery, and storage automation initiatives

    TO BE SUCCESSFUL, YOU'LL NEED EXPERIENCE SUCH AS:
    • Extensive hands-on experience administering and supporting NetApp ONTAP environments
    • Strong expertise with NetApp Core Technologies, including:
      • FAS platforms
      • AFF platforms
    • Experience with Kubernetes and containerized storage integrations
    • Experience with ASA Fibre Channel environments
    • Knowledge of SAN and Fibre Channel architectures
    • Demonstrated experience performing hardware troubleshooting, maintenance, and break/fix activities
    • Strong understanding of enterprise storage architecture, SAN/NAS technologies, and data management
    • Experience with performance tuning, storage optimization, and capacity management
    • Excellent analytical, troubleshooting, and problem-solving skills
    • Proven ability to work independently while providing proactive and consultative support
    • Strong verbal and written communication skills with the ability to interact effectively with technical and business stakeholders

    P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:
    • NetApp certifications such as:
      • NCDA
      • NCIE
      • Other relevant NetApp certifications
